London close: Markets rebound strongly, Carnival jumps late on

Tue, 25th Jun 2013 16:44

The FTSE 100 rebounded strongly with a 1.2 per cent jump on Tuesday after coming close to its 2013 low the day before, as concerns over a liquidity crunch in China and reduced stimulus in the US eased, for the time being at least.London's benchmark index finished the session up 73 points at 6,102, after having dropped to 6,029 on Monday, its worst level since early January.However, speaking this afternoon, Market Strategist Ishaq Siddiqi from ETX Capital said: "Putting the fundamentals aside and speaking technically, today's price-action in Europe is merely a dead-cat bounce and this rally is likely to lose steam in the coming sessions."Policymakers attempt to ease fearsStocks were given a boost this morning by comments from certain members of the Federal Reserve who said that markets have overreacted to Chairman Ben Bernanke's suggestion of a 'taper' last week. Minneapolis Fed President Narayana Kocherlakota yesterday released a statement and held a press conference to say that there was a "misperception" that the Fed has taken a more hawkish turn. He assured that the central bank was committed to an easy-money policy until the jobless rate falls further.Similarly, outgoing Bank of England Governor Mervyn King said today before the Treasury Select Committee that financial markets have "jumped the gun" in betting that interest rates will return to 'normal' levels in the near future. He said: "The Federal Reserve has merely said that the easing in which it is still engaging may taper at some point depending on economic conditions [...] Bernanke made it 100% obvious it will depend on the incoming data ... No one would sit down today and say this is the path of interest rates we intend to follow. That would be crazy."Meanwhile, as worries mount over the credit squeeze in China, the country's central bank has downplayed fears saying that money-market fluctuations are temporary and that there is ample liquidity in the system, lifting market sentiment further today.FTSE 100: Carnival jump on boardroom change, Q2 resultsCruise operator Carnival surged late on after announcing that it is splitting Micky Arison's roles as Chairman and Chief Executive Officer (CEO), with long-running board member Arnold Donald stepping up to the CEO position. The news came alongside the firm's second-quarter results with earnings per share excluding unrealised losses on fuel derivatives coming in at 9.0 US cents, ahead of the 7.0 cents expected by Bloomberg consensus.Oilfield service company Petrofac was under the weather after forecasting "modest growth" this year with results expected to be "significantly weighted towards the second half". Consumer packaging giant Rexam was also heavy faller after admitting that full-year trading will be below expectations after a slowdown in beverage can volumes growth in the first half. The company also announced its intention to sell off its Healthcare business.Chip designer ARM Holdings was a high riser this morning after Investec upgraded the group from 'hold' to 'buy' after a 32% fall in the shares since an analyst day in May. "We see ARM as the most attractive long term investment in the sector with underpinned earnings growth."Financial services group Prudential was making gains this morning after Berenberg said that the stock's recent pull-back on emerging market concerns "represents a rare buying opportunity".Similarly, Fresnillo was higher after Citigroup raised the precious metals miner from 'sell' to 'neutral' after a recent sharp fall in the share price.Telecoms giant Vodafone was making gains a day after launching a £6.6bn takeover offer for Kabel Deutscheland. The stock was given a lift this morning by Nomura which upgraded its rating from 'neutral' to 'buy'.FTSE 250: House builders gain after dataHouse builders and construction stocks were performing well on Tuesday after the British Bankers' Association revealed that mortgage approvals for house purchase hit a 16-month high in May of 36,102. Ashtead, Balfour Beatty and Barratt Developments were among the best performers this afternoon.Industrial coding, printing and marking technology group Domino Printing was lower after swinging into a pre-tax loss for the half year as difficult trading conditions across most of Europe persisted.Kazakhmys was rebounding after some heavy falls the day before. The company yesterday recommended shareholders to vote in favour of an offer for its 26% stake in ENRC, saying that it is the best option for shareholders despite the price being lower than hoped.Hotel group Millenium & Copthorne was in the red after Morgan Stanley cut its recommendation for the shares from 'overweight' to 'equal weight'.
